8+ Best Sales Executive Resume Formats & Examples

A document structuring professional history and qualifications for sales executive roles typically emphasizes accomplishments, quantifiable results, and relevant skills. This structure often includes sections for contact information, a summary or objective statement, professional experience, education, skills, and awards or recognitions. An example would be a chronological presentation of work history highlighting progressively increasing sales targets achieved and contributions to revenue growth.

Effective organization and clear presentation of information are vital for making a strong first impression. A well-structured presentation allows recruiters to quickly identify key competencies and determine suitability for a role. Chronological, functional, and combination formats each offer unique advantages depending on individual career paths and the specific requirements of a target position. Over time, best practices have evolved to reflect changing hiring trends and technological advancements in applicant tracking systems.

8+ Best Truck Driver Resume Word Formats (2023)

A professional document tailored for the trucking industry typically uses a clear and concise structure, emphasizing relevant experience and skills. This often involves sections for contact information, a summary of qualifications, a detailed work history showcasing driving experience and safety records, skills related to operating commercial vehicles, and certifications or licenses. A chronological format, listing experiences in reverse order of occurrence, is commonly preferred. Specific keywords relevant to the trucking industry are often incorporated to optimize visibility in applicant tracking systems.

Effective presentation of qualifications is crucial for securing employment in a competitive field. A well-structured and targeted document can significantly improve an applicant’s chances of getting noticed by recruiters and hiring managers. By highlighting relevant experience, certifications, and skills, candidates can demonstrate their suitability for specific roles and increase their prospects of landing interviews. The increasing use of digital platforms and applicant tracking systems in recruitment further emphasizes the need for an optimized document, making a strong first impression paramount.

9+ Sr. Accountant Resume Formats (2024)

A well-structured presentation of a senior accountant’s qualifications and experience is essential for career advancement. This typically involves a chronological or functional layout, highlighting relevant skills and accomplishments. A chronological approach lists work history in reverse chronological order, emphasizing career progression. A functional approach focuses on skills and abilities, particularly useful for those with career gaps or changes. Both should incorporate quantifiable achievements, using numbers and metrics to demonstrate impact.

An effective presentation of professional credentials significantly increases the likelihood of securing interviews. It provides hiring managers with a clear and concise overview of a candidate’s suitability for senior accounting roles. This is particularly crucial in a competitive job market where a compelling presentation can differentiate a candidate from others. Historically, the emphasis has shifted from simply listing duties to showcasing accomplishments and demonstrating value. This evolution reflects the increasing demand for accountants who can not only manage finances but also contribute strategically to organizational growth.
